Catholic couples counseling is a form of therapy that focuses on strengthening relationships through the lens of faith. It recognizes the importance of faith in building a strong foundation for a healthy and fulfilling relationship. In Catholic couples counseling, couples are encouraged to explore their faith together and use it as a guiding force in their relationship. This article will delve into the significance of faith in Catholic couples counseling and how it can help couples connect with their faith and strengthen their relationship.

The Importance of Faith in Catholic Couples Counseling
Faith plays a crucial role in Catholic couples counseling as it provides a solid foundation for a strong relationship. When couples share a common faith, they have a shared set of values, beliefs, and principles that guide their actions and decisions. This shared faith can help couples navigate challenges and conflicts, as they have a common ground to turn to for guidance and support.
Catholic couples counseling recognizes the importance of faith in building trust and intimacy within a relationship. Faith encourages couples to be vulnerable with each other, to share their fears, hopes, and dreams, and to support each other in their spiritual journey. By incorporating faith into their relationship, couples can deepen their connection on a spiritual level, which can enhance their emotional and physical intimacy as well.
Understanding the Role of Faith in Strengthening Relationships
Faith can help couples overcome challenges and build trust in several ways. Firstly, faith teaches forgiveness and compassion, which are essential qualities in any relationship. When couples face difficulties or conflicts, faith encourages them to approach these challenges with love and understanding rather than anger or resentment. This mindset allows for healing and growth within the relationship.
Secondly, faith can improve communication and understanding between partners. By incorporating prayer and reflection into their daily lives, couples can develop a deeper understanding of each other’s needs, desires, and struggles. This understanding fosters empathy and compassion, leading to more effective communication and problem-solving within the relationship.

FAQs
What is Catholic couples counseling?
Catholic couples counseling is a form of therapy that is designed to help couples who are struggling with their relationship. It is based on the teachings of the Catholic Church and aims to help couples improve their communication, resolve conflicts, and strengthen their bond.
Who can benefit from Catholic couples counseling?
Catholic couples counseling can benefit any couple who is experiencing difficulties in their relationship. It can be particularly helpful for couples who are struggling with issues related to faith, spirituality, or morality.
What happens during a Catholic couples counseling session?
During a Catholic couples counseling session, the therapist will work with the couple to identify the issues that are causing problems in their relationship. They will then help the couple to develop strategies for addressing these issues and improving their communication and intimacy.
Is Catholic couples counseling only for Catholics?
No, Catholic couples counseling is not only for Catholics. While the counseling is based on Catholic teachings, it can be helpful for any couple who is looking to improve their relationship.
How long does Catholic couples counseling last?
The length of Catholic couples counseling can vary depending on the needs of the couple. Some couples may only need a few sessions, while others may require more extensive therapy.
Is Catholic couples counseling effective?
Yes, Catholic couples counseling can be very effective in helping couples to improve their relationship. Studies have shown that couples who participate in counseling are more likely to stay together and report higher levels of satisfaction in their relationship.
